exopathogen (medicine)


exopathogen


A disease-causing virus or bacteria which causes plant diseases from outside of the plant, without having to invade the plant's tissues.


enzyme stabilisation (medicine)


enzyme stabilisation
Reducing the chances that an enzyme will inactivate in vitro (see enzyme inactivation) by changing the environmental conditions (such as pH, temperature, concentration of salt, etc.) or by attaching organic groups to it or changing some of its amino acid subunits.
